Answered step by step
Verified Expert Solution
Link Copied!

Question

1 Approved Answer

In java, the class Date was designed and implemented to keep track of a date, but it has very limited operations. Redefine the class Date

In java, the class Date was designed and implemented to keep track of a date, but it has very limited operations. Redefine the class Date so that, in addition to the operation already defned, it can perform the following operations on a date: set a month, set a day, set a year, return a month, return a day, return a year, test whether the year is a leap year, return the number of days in a month. Return the number of days passed in the year, Return the number of days remaining in the year, Calculate the new date by adding a fixed number of days to the date, Return a reference to the object containing a copy of the date, make a copy of another date, and write the definition of the methods to implement the operations defined for the class Date. //I need this in JAVA

Step by Step Solution

There are 3 Steps involved in it

Step: 1

blur-text-image

Get Instant Access to Expert-Tailored Solutions

See step-by-step solutions with expert insights and AI powered tools for academic success

Step: 2

blur-text-image

Step: 3

blur-text-image

Ace Your Homework with AI

Get the answers you need in no time with our AI-driven, step-by-step assistance

Get Started

Recommended Textbook for

Database And Expert Systems Applications 24th International Conference Dexa 2013 Prague Czech Republic August 2013 Proceedings Part 1 Lncs 8055

Authors: Hendrik Decker ,Lenka Lhotska ,Sebastian Link ,Josef Basl ,A Min Tjoa

2013 Edition

3642402844, 978-3642402845

More Books

Students also viewed these Databases questions